Lange sah die Bromance von US-Präsident Trump und Elon Musk aus wie die perfekte Kombination von Macht und Geld. Anfang Juni endete die Zusammenarbeit im öffentlichen Streit über einen Gesetzesvorschlag, der derzeit im US-Senat beraten wird. Das Vorhaben sieht weitreichende Steuer- und Ausgabenumstellungen vor und würde zentrale Punkte von Trumps politischer Agenda umsetzen. Gleichzeitig würde das Paket jedoch die Staatsverschuldung um mehrere Billionen Dollar in die Höhe treiben. Musk, der bis Ende Mai als Sonderberater für die US-Regierung tätig war, begründete seine scharfe Kritik an dem Entwurf mit dem hohen Haushaltsdefizit und bezeichnete das Gesetz als »ekelhafte Abscheulichkeit«. In this episode of The Rickey Smiley Morning Show Podcast, the team delves into the escalating feud between former allies Donald Trump and Elon Musk. The conflict ignited when Musk publicly criticized Trump's "One Big Beautiful Bill," labeling it a "disgusting abomination" due to its potential to increase the national deficit and cut electric vehicle subsidies. Trump retaliated by threatening to revoke federal contracts with Musk's companies and dismissed Musk as having "lost his mind." This public spat has caused divisions within Silicon Valley and raised questions about the future of their political alliance. What a wild week it's been for NASA. With drastic budget cuts looming—pending any action by Congress—then comes the sudden and unexpected pulling of Jared Isaacman for the role of NASA Administrator, with no replacement named. Then came the very public split between President Trump and Elon Musk, and a flurry of furious Twitter/X and Truth Social postings, aimed at each other with razor-sharp edges. And finally, the proposed and drastic cuts to NASA outreach and education budgets, slimming them to nearly nothing. These are strange and concerning times for America's space agency, a premier global brand and icon of peaceful American prowess. We turned to Casey Dreier, the Chief of Space Policy for The Planetary Society, who has been quite vocal in his concern, for context. These are critical times for spaceflight, so you won't want to miss this episode!Headlines Trump and Musk "Bromance" Ends: Rod Pyle and Tariq Malik discuss the public falling out between Donald Trump and Elon Musk, which included Trump's threats to cancel SpaceX contracts and Musk's counter-accusations regarding the Jeffrey Epstein files. Commercial Crew Program and Boeing's Starliner: Tariq Malik highlights the critical role of SpaceX's Dragon in NASA's commercial crew program, especially given Boeing's Starliner delays, making NASA dependent on SpaceX for U.S. independent access to space. Japanese ispace Lunar Lander Failure: Rod Pyle and Tariq Malik discuss the second failed attempt by the Japanese company ispace to land its Hakuto-R lunar lander on the moon, losing the European Space Agency's mini-rover, called Tenacious, in the process. Speculation on SpaceX Nationalization: The hosts discuss online speculation, including from Steve Bannon, about the possibility of the U.S. government nationalizing SpaceX, and Elon Musk's subsequent de-escalation. LAUNCH Act: Rod Pyle introduces the bipartisan LAUNCH Act, aimed at streamlining licensing for commercial space companies to encourage more rocket launches with faster approvals. Senate Reconciliation Bill: Tariq Malik and Rod Pyle discuss Senator Ted Cruz's Senate reconciliation bill, which proposes to restore funding for the Space Launch System (SLS), increase NASA's budget by $10 billion, and fund Artemis 4 and 5, missions previously targeted for alternate architectures. 60th Anniversary of First U.S. Spacewalk: The hosts commemorate Ed White's historic spacewalk during the Gemini 4 mission in 1965 and discuss anecdotes and lingering questions surrounding the event. Definition of an Astronaut/Spacewalker Debate: Rod Pyle and Tariq Malik briefly touch on the ongoing debate about what defines an "astronaut" or "spacewalker," given varying definitions and commercial spaceflight. Tribute to Marc Garneau: The hosts pay tribute to Marc Garneau, Canada's first astronaut, who passed away at 76, highlighting his career with the Canadian Space Agency and his later political career.
